Output 51e1f93d824f65a4c2b13554c4c87778844d4f8298ab9f577c9db94af9f12396:3

value
3321286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bca771c34532b56e37d834653bff3a932cf93f2 OP_EQUAL
address
38bm9TvBTtsADiTuqqG3kko2RSHqbk1zeM
transaction
51e1f93d824f65a4c2b13554c4c87778844d4f8298ab9f577c9db94af9f12396
spent
true